Russian forces are mentioned to have entered the Azovstal steelworks, the closing hold-out of Ukrainian forces inside the southern port town of Mariupol. Russia has besieged and bombarded the town for weeks. It is key to Moscow's army campaign in Ukraine. But why?
Land bridge: Control of the metropolis offers the Russians a land bridge from Russia, via components of the Donbas area held using Russian-sponsored separatists, proper through to Crimea, which Russia annexed in 2014.
Hitting Ukraine's financial system: Mariupol has long been a strategically vital port on the Sea of Azov, part of the Black Sea. In everyday instances, the city is a key export hub for Ukraine's metal, coal, and corn. Losing its miles is a chief blow to Ukraine's economy.
Russian propaganda: Among Mariupol's defenders are the Azov Brigade, which has hyperlinks to a long way-right extremist, historically including neo-Nazis. They shape handiest the tiniest fraction of Ukraine's fighting forces, however, their presence is frequently used as a pretext for Russia's declaration to be ridding Ukraine of Nazis.
Free up forces: An quit to the prolonged warfare for the city could launch extra of Russia's troops for its push to take manage of the ultimate components of the Donbas in JAP Ukraine, made of Luhansk and Donetsk.

Zelensky says he is in opposition to the Ukraine conflict turning into a 'frozen war' :
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ky is "now no longer going to comply with a frozen war" with Russia, he has stated at some stage in a video cope with on the Wall Street Journal CEO Council Summit. Frozen conflicts are zones of ongoing instability, which Russia has formerly been accused of the use of to its advantage. Zelensky says preceding agreements with Russia inclusive of Minsk-1 and 2, which sought to quit the war in Ukraine's Donbas region, "have been violated" through Russia and "has been now no longer serious". "Ukraine will honestly now no longer move into any such diplomatic swamp again," Zelensky has stated.
